Enviado em 20/06/2019 - 22:46h
Boa noite pessoal, estou tentando fazer um código, para mostrar um banner em meu site, quando o usuário entrar, baseado na localização dele. É basicamente o seguinte: a API de geolocalização retorna o nome da cidade, e, se for a cidade, então mostre o banner. Se não for, mostre outro. O código JavaScript que estou usando é esse:<script type="application/javascript">
function geoip(json){
var city = document.getElementById("user_city");
city.textContent = json.city;
}
</script>
<script async src="https://get.geojs.io/v1/ip/geo.js"></script>
A cidade é: <span id="user_city"></span>
<script type="application/javascript">
function geoip(json){
var city = document.getElementById("user_city");
city.textContent = json.city;
}
if (city == "nomedacidade") {
document.write ("<img src='banner1.jpg'></img>");
}
else {
document.write ("<img src='banner2.jpg'></img>");
}
</script>
<script async src="https://get.geojs.io/v1/ip/geo.js"></script>
Aprenda a Gerenciar Permissões de Arquivos no Linux
Como transformar um áudio em vídeo com efeito de forma de onda (wave form)
Como aprovar Pull Requests em seu repositório Github via linha de comando
Visualizar arquivos em formato markdown (ex.: README.md) pelo terminal
Dando - teoricamente - um gás no Gnome-Shell do Arch Linux
Como instalar o Google Cloud CLI no Ubuntu/Debian
Mantenha seu Sistema Leve e Rápido com a Limpeza do APT!
Procurando vídeos de YouTube pelo terminal e assistindo via mpv (2025)
como instalar o steam no twiteros 2.0.2(arm) (5)
Zorin OS - Virtual Box não consigo abrir maquinas virtuais (2)
O que você está ouvindo agora? [2] (182)